Flower Garden - Estate Sterling Silver Ruby & Pearl Filigree Dangly Earrings. These exquisite earrings are crafted from sterling silver, hallmarked 925 for sterling. Featuring two genuine rubies, eight genuine pearls, Edwardian Revival styling, and quality craftsmanship. These lovely earrings showcase beautiful deep red rubies in the centre of the galleries. The precious gems are surround by 4 silvery grey pearls, and a sea of filigree. The earrings are for pierced ears, and feature posts and secure butterfly backs. History: Records suggest that rubies were traded along China's North Silk Road as early as 200 BC. Chinese noblemen adorned their armor with rubies because they believed the gem would grant protection. Burma has been a significant ruby source since at least 600 AD.

Pearls were presented as gifts to Chinese royalty as early as 2300 BC, while in ancient Rome, pearl jewellery was considered the ultimate status symbol. So precious were the spherical gems that in the 1st century BC, Julius Caesar passed a law limiting the wearing of pearls only to the ruling classes.

The first evidence of silver mining dates back to 3000 B.C., in Turkey and Greece, according to the RSC. Ancient people even figured out how to refine silver. They heated the silver ore and blew air over it, a process called cupellation.

The sterling alloy originated in continental Europe and was being used for commerce as early as the 12th century in the area that is now northern Germany. A piece of sterling silver dating from Henry II's reign was used as a standard in the Trial of the Pyx until it was deposited at the Royal Mint in 1843.
